Output 70be61381d1570ec6521cd84c94aa20c34ee7c7d7b8c1646fb1af46686c25efc:0

value
186922
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a9620157a483f8f79be6851c700b2bbd666ab0b7e69396fd03e4683f1c6d762b
address
tb1p493qz4ays0u00xlxs5w8qzeth4nx4v9hu6fedlgru35r78rdwc4sp7anq7
transaction
70be61381d1570ec6521cd84c94aa20c34ee7c7d7b8c1646fb1af46686c25efc
confirmations
18418
spent
true